LAHORE: Pakistan’s Aisam ul Haq together with Indian Rohan Bopanna made it to the quarter final of the Kremlin Cup ATP World Championship defeating L. Fridle of Czech Republic and V. Hanescu of Romania 6-1,3-6,10-8 in Moscow on Wednesday.
In the first set Aisam and Rohan totally dominated their opponents and clearly dictated the terms of proceedings on court as they broke Friedl & Haneseu’s serve twice on way to grabbing the set,said the information made available here.
In the second set, however, the fates were completely reversed as Aisam and Rohan’s serve was broken twice and they were 1-5 down at one point of time. Thanks to a few outclass return winners by them they were able to break back and then by holding their own serve were able to make it 3-5.Here again they played very well to take the score to 40-40 from being 0-30 on Hanescu’s serve but were unable to prevent Hanescu from closing the set with a 6-3 score.In the super tie break Aisam & Rohan put enormous pressure on Friedl and Hanescu as they made it 3-0 but their lead was later neutralized when they lost their advantage. At 7-8 however they were again able to get a break up to make it 9-8 and made no more mistake in winning the next point on their own serve to take the super tie break and the match – App
